Gabala International Airport (GBB) Guide: Gabala, Azerbaijan

Gabala International Airport is the small airport serving Azerbaijan’s mountain resort region of Gabala. GBB is useful when flights operate, but it is not a big all-day transport hub: schedules are thin, public transport is limited, and travelers should arrange pickup before flying.

Quick airport facts

Item Details
Full airport name Gabala International Airport
Short codes GBB / UBBQ
Also searched as Qabala Airport, Qebele Airport, Qəbələ Airport
City and country Gabala, Azerbaijan
Practical address South of Gabala / Qabala, Azerbaijan; coordinates 40.808617, 47.725389.
Distance to city About 13-15 km from Gabala town; most transfers take 15-30 minutes by road.
Updated 2026-06-15
  • Best for: Gabala resorts, Tufandag, mountain breaks, family holidays, and northern Azerbaijan road trips.
  • Main route logic: limited scheduled service, often seasonal or Baku-connected; live schedule checks are essential.
  • Airport style: small mountain-region airport with basic passenger services.
  • Planning rule: pre-book hotel pickup because taxi/rideshare supply can be weak.

How to get from the airport to the city

Option Typical time Approximate cost Best use
Hotel/private pickup 15-30 min Often included or USD 15-35 equivalent ✅ Best and most reliable option.
Informal/local taxi 15-30 min Agree fare first; budget AZN 20-40 🚕 Works only if arranged or available.
Rental car 20 min to town; longer mountain roads From about USD 35-80/day 🚗 Best for Sheki, Tufandag, and lake routes.
Public transport Not dependable at terminal No reliable airport fare ⚠️ Do not make this the main arrival plan.

Ride-hailing coverage is not as reliable as in Baku. If arriving on an infrequent flight, your accommodation should know the schedule and send a driver.

Public transport and metro

Gabala has no metro or airport rail link.

Where public transport exists, it is usually best for daylight arrivals with light luggage. For late flights, family travel, heavy bags, or first-time visits, a taxi, hotel transfer, or pre-booked private driver is usually worth the extra cost.

Airport facilities, shops, and restaurants

  • Small terminal with basic check-in, security, baggage, and limited refreshments.
  • Do not expect broad shops, banking, or full restaurant choice.
  • Bring Azerbaijani manat cash from Baku if possible.
  • Winter mountain conditions can affect road timing.

The smart rule at GBB is to treat the terminal as a transfer point rather than as a shopping destination. Eat before arriving when possible, keep a refillable bottle where security rules allow, and bring a small power bank. If you have a long delay, an airport-area hotel or city hotel is usually more comfortable than waiting in the terminal.

Airlines and where the airport flies

Public schedule tools give mixed results for GBB because service is limited and seasonal. Some tools show Abu Dhabi or Baku-style availability at times, while others show no regular direct flights; verify with AZAL, the airport, and live booking engines.

AZAL/Azerbaijan Airlines is the first airline to check for domestic or seasonal service. International leisure or charter flights may appear only in specific periods.

Cheap routes to check first

  • Gabala to Baku: check first if domestic service operates.
  • Gabala to Abu Dhabi or Gulf routes: verify dates because service can be seasonal.
  • Baku by road as backup: often more reliable than forcing a rare GBB flight.

Cheap airport strategy is different from simply sorting by lowest fare. Always compare the final cost after checked baggage, seat selection, payment fees, transfer costs, and missed-connection risk. A slightly more expensive flight into the correct airport can be cheaper than a low base fare that forces a long taxi ride or overnight hotel.

Safety and travel notes

Gabala is a relaxed resort region, but winter roads and mountain activities need normal caution. Confirm pickup, carry cash, and keep travel insurance active for outdoor plans.
